KOTA KINABALU: Sabah will consider using solar lamps to light up streets in rural and hard to reach areas, especially places without electricity supply, the state assembly was told.
Assistant Rural Development Minister Samad Jambri Jamri said the state government had taken note of the suggestion to use solar-powered lighting in such areas.
